Flash fiction submission…only it’s not fiction!

Hi.  My name is Niko, and Mom and Dad and I lost our home. An earthquake split our house in half! I’m a miniature dachshund. I could have crawled through the tented floor inside but I didn’t. I’m a smart dog.

We had to move. Pet rentals are hard to find. We visited one, and I got the lease! The landlord wanted the smallest dog! Mom and Dad were very proud of me.

I know all about pet rentals. Nasty smells everywhere. The carpets are the worst. I don’t even bother marking them. I can’t overpower these old pee smells, but I marked every tree outside. I’m a good dog and I know my duties.

Mom wanted a new throw rug. What color would it be? I can only see black, white, yellow and blue. Mom’s pup surprised us with “textured wool.”  I think that means a bumpy carpet.

When they unrolled it, I didn’t smell any pee! Time to start marking so everyone knows this house is ours. And the best part? I could see the color!

I’d better get to work for Mom and Dad.  Time to pee on our new white rug.
